Chand Population - Kaimur, Bihar

Chand is a large village located in Chand Block of Kaimur district, Bihar with total 700 families residing. The Chand village has population of 4432 of which 2344 are males while 2088 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Chand village population of children with age 0-6 is 849 which makes up 19.16 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Chand village is 891 which is lower than Bihar state average of 918. Child Sex Ratio for the Chand as per census is 887, lower than Bihar average of 935.

Chand village has higher literacy rate compared to Bihar. In 2011, literacy rate of Chand village was 71.73 % compared to 61.80 % of Bihar. In Chand Male literacy stands at 81.63 % while female literacy rate was 60.63 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 16.16 % while Schedule Tribe (ST) were 0.81 % of total population in Chand village.

Work Profile

In Chand village out of total population, 1339 were engaged in work activities. 63.48 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 36.52 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 1339 workers engaged in Main Work, 365 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 168 were Agricultural labourer.
